APPG launches Excellence in School Food Awards
EB News: 02/12/2021 - 13:16
The All Party Parliamentary Group (APPG) on school food has announced their Excellence in School Food Awards 2021/22 are now open for entries.
The awards are aimed at recognising excellence in innovation within the school food sector in three categories: groups, individuals and schools.
The groups category can go to an organisation, charity or catering team who have used the initiative to serve healthy food to children and have achieved positive outcomes for local communities and children.
The Individuals category will go to an individual who has shown individual commitment; someone whose ideas and innovation have changed things for the better; someone who has had a significant impact on local communities and children.
The schools category can go to either an in-house catering team, head teacher, teacher(s) or support staff – who have come up with a creative initiative to serve healthy food to children within the school setting.
